The term 'Orientalism' in the context of Indian literature refers to:

  1. The glorification of Indian culture by Western writers

  2. The depiction of India as exotic and mysterious by Western writers

  3. The study of Indian languages and literature by Western scholars

  4. The influence of Indian literature on Western literature

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
B Correct answer
Explanation

Orientalism, as a concept, refers to the way in which the West has historically perceived and represented the East, often exoticizing and romanticizing it.
